Bill Cosby has yet to explicitly address the numerous allegations of sexual assault that have been levied against him, but he does have a message for the members of the media who are covering the story.
"I only expect the black media to uphold the standards of excellence in journalism and when you do that you have to go in with a neutral mind," Cosby told the New York Post this week.

Among Cosby's accusers are former supermodels Janice Dickinson and Beverly Johnson.
When asked how his wife Camille was dealing with the accusations against her husband, Cosby told the Post: "Love and the strength of womanhood."
The comedian declined to comment further, the Post reports.
